Why AI matters at this scale

Eagle County School District operates as a public K-12 educational institution serving a community in Colorado. With a staff size of 501-1,000, it manages multiple schools, curricula, transportation, and administrative functions under tight public funding constraints. At this mid-size district scale, operational efficiency and personalized student support are constant challenges. AI presents a transformative lever to address both: by automating routine administrative tasks, it frees educators to focus on teaching; by analyzing student data, it enables early intervention and tailored learning paths. For a district of this size, the volume of data generated—from grades and attendance to behavioral notes—is substantial but often underutilized. AI tools can synthesize this information to provide actionable insights, moving from reactive to proactive district management. The sector's gradual digital transformation, accelerated by pandemic-driven EdTech adoption, has created a foundation upon which AI solutions can be built, though integration must navigate legacy systems and stringent data privacy regulations.

Three Concrete AI Opportunities with ROI Framing

1. Adaptive Learning Platforms for Differentiated Instruction: Implementing AI-driven software that adjusts lesson difficulty and pacing in real-time based on individual student performance. This directly addresses achievement gaps without requiring teachers to manually create dozens of lesson variants. ROI manifests through improved standardized test scores (tying to funding), reduced need for expensive remedial tutoring programs, and higher student engagement leading to better attendance-based funding.

2. Predictive Analytics for Student Retention: Deploying machine learning models to analyze historical and current student data (attendance, grade trends, socio-economic markers) to identify students at high risk of dropping out or falling severely behind. Early flagging allows counselors and support staff to intervene with targeted resources. The ROI is significant: preventing even a handful of dropouts saves the district tens of thousands in future lost per-pupil state funding, while improving community outcomes.

3. Intelligent Process Automation for Administration: Using natural language processing and robotic process automation to handle time-consuming paperwork like Individualized Education Program (IEP) draft generation, scheduling, compliance reporting, and parent communication. This reduces administrative overhead and burnout. The ROI is clear in labor cost savings, allowing existing staff to manage larger workloads or reallocating FTEs to direct student support roles, improving services without increasing headcount.

Deployment Risks Specific to This Size Band

For a mid-size public district, risks are pronounced. Budget cycles and grant dependency mean pilot projects must show quick, tangible value to secure ongoing funding. IT infrastructure is often fragmented, with a mix of legacy systems and modern SaaS, creating integration headaches and potential data silos that undermine AI effectiveness. Data privacy and security are paramount; a breach involving student data would be catastrophic. Vendors must be vetted for strict compliance with FERPA, COPPA, and state laws. Change management is critical. Teacher and staff buy-in can't be assumed; AI must be framed as a tool to augment, not replace, human expertise. Successful deployment requires extensive training and involving educators in the design process to ensure tools solve real classroom problems.

Frequently asked

Common questions about AI for k-12 education management

How can AI help with teacher shortages?
AI automates grading, lesson planning, and administrative tasks, allowing teachers to focus on high-impact instruction and student relationships.
Is student data safe with AI systems?
Federated learning and on-premise deployments can minimize data exposure. Vendor compliance with FERPA and COPPA is non-negotiable.
What's the ROI timeline for AI in education?
Efficiency gains (e.g., automated reporting) show ROI in 6-12 months; student outcome improvements may take 2-3 years to measure fully.
How do we get buy-in from skeptical teachers?
Pilot programs co-designed with teachers, emphasizing tools that reduce burnout rather than replace human judgment, build trust.
